Address

oTpb6LgHqbJeMoWrJRPDRxjvwbNam4R1a4

0 OWO

Confirmed
Total Received14.99422303 OWO0.01 USD
Total Sent14.99422303 OWO0.01 USD
Final Balance0 OWO0.00 USD
No. Transactions2

Transactions

oeamfrbk3cWpRMgW25frGggz2G6zq722k61.59425306 OWO0.00 USD0.00 USD
oTpb6LgHqbJeMoWrJRPDRxjvwbNam4R1a414.99422303 OWO0.02 USD0.01 USD
oWGtw3VpkdVtXXQk1jrHkYCubVW3kP8x5v7.98265663 OWO0.01 USD0.00 USD
ob3XMqoUMWrY39oXTtKSmSoACgsDJHaNH414.99422263 OWO0.02 USD0.01 USD
ofhSMX4TLa3e3hiw577Nu7UCaUZch8hnmw1.54796453 OWO0.00 USD0.00 USD
 
oPNwFXC2QKu8t1r7nzoFf2MuwrWzUhLnbJ1.1074844 OWO0.00 USD0.00 USD
ofEcEUY8JCSgcrZiGAaigvD3fP6yfczXoP25000 OWO26.53 USD10.05 USD
 
ofEcEUY8JCSgcrZiGAaigvD3fP6yfczXoP25000 OWO26.53 USD10.05 USD
oTpb6LgHqbJeMoWrJRPDRxjvwbNam4R1a414.99422303 OWO0.02 USD0.01 USD